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8696 91999107 78659757
8551041813 67642 03717
8551041813 67642 03717
5613 2490052620 120
All about undefined
Interested in learning more?
8551041813 67642 03717
5613 2490052620 120
See more
59 3382303 77
1410 07991564650 50
See more
16937013 36 118439
753443556 01463056048 5927663 81 81
See more